web-dev-qa-db-ja.com

使用されているサウンドシステムを知るにはどうすればよいですか?

ALSA、OSS、PULSEAUDIOがあることに気づきました。何を使用しているのかを知るにはどうすればよいですか?

(MythBuntu 10.04を実行していて、すべてのアプリ(VLC、Baseroなど)をSPDIF経由で出力する方法を知りたいです)。

1
prule

さまざまなアプリケーションがさまざまな「サウンドシステム」を利用できます。一部のアプリケーションでは、実行時にサウンドバックエンドを選択できます(たとえば、設定を介して)。それ以外の場合、これはコンパイル時の選択である必要があります(したがって、1つを選択するのはパッケージメンテナ次第です)。

メインのUbuntuリポジトリにあるアプリケーションは PulseAudio サポートでコンパイルされているため、システム->環境設定->サウンドを介してサウンドの入力と出力を制御できます。 )または padevchooser

それでも、一部のアプリケーションはPulseAudioをサポートせず、ALSA/OSSの選択肢しか提供しません。古いバージョンのSkypeとAdobe Flashが主な例ですが、無料の音楽プレーヤー Aqualung もあります。

したがって、最終的には、答えは次のとおりです。これはアプリケーション固有であり、アプリケーションの設定を掘り下げるか、アップグレード/再コンパイルして、希望どおりに機能させる必要がある場合があります。

4
Riccardo Murri

サウンドが機能している場合は、タスクバーの音量アイコンを右クリックして、[設定]をクリックします。使用しているシステムが上部に表示されます。

PS:それは私が現在使用しているUbuntu9.04でどのように起こるかです。

0
theTuxRacer